Step 1: Assessment and Dehumidification
Our team will assess the damage and begin the dehumidification process, using equipment like desiccant dehumidifiers and industrial fans to remove standing water and moisture from the affected areas.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and growth of mold and mildew.
Step 2: Water Removal and Drying
We’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ove standing water from your floors. Our team will then apply specialized drying equipment, including air movers and dehumidifiers, to ensure your floors dry thoroughly and evenly.
Step 3: Disinfection and Cleaning
Once the floors have dried, our team will disinfect and clean the affected areas using eco-friendly products and state-of-the-art cleaning equipment, ensuring that your floors are safe and healthy for you and your family.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Depending on the extent of the damage, our team may need to repair or replace damaged flooring materials, including wood, carpet, tile, or other flooring types. We’ll work closely with you to find out the best course of action and make necessary adjustments.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ification
Once the restoration process is complete, our team will conduct a thorough inspection to ensure that your floors are safe and meet your expectations. We’ll also provide you with a final inspection report and certification, including before and after photos and a detailed report of the work completed.

Warning Signs You Need Floor Water Damage Restoration
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A musty smell that persists, even after cleaning, is a clear indication of water damage. It’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ent mold growth and further damage.
Buckled or Warped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ring is a clear sign of water damage. If you notice this issue, don’t delay; our team will work quickly to restore your floors to their original condition.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ains or discoloration on your floors can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these signs; our team will work to remove the stains and restore your floors.
Slippery or Spongy Floors
Slippery or spongy floors are a clear indication of water damage. Our team will work to dry and restore your floors, ensuring they’re safe and healthy for you and your family.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old or mildew growth on your floors is a serious issue that needs immediate attention. Our team will work to remove the mold and mildew, ensuring your floors are safe and healthy.
Water Droplets or Condensation
Water droplets or condensation on your floors can be a sign of water damage. Our team will work to identify the source of the issue and restore your floors to their original condition.

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Afton, OK
The cost of Floor Water Damage Restoration in Afton, OK, can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a general breakdown of the costs involved in the process: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water, type of flooring, and equipment needed. |
| Disinfection and cleaning | $300 – $1,500 | The type of flooring, extent of damage, and eco-friendly products used. |
| Restoration and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| The type of flooring, extent of damage, and materials needed. |
| Final inspection and certification | $100 – $500 | The extent of the inspection and certification required. |

What is the best way to prevent water damage?
The best way to prevent water damage is to be proactive. Regularly inspect your home’s plumbing, appliances, and roof for signs of damage or wear. Stay alert for unusual odors or sounds, and address issues quickly.
